Job Overview

Position Summary:

The Community Partnership Coordinator is integral to advancing the mission of God's Pantry Food Bank by overseeing fundraising initiatives and fostering community collaborations. This role focuses on establishing and nurturing relationships with businesses, corporations, faith-based organizations, and civic groups across the Food Bank's extensive service area.

Key Responsibilities:

Partnership Development

  • Initiate and cultivate innovative partnerships with businesses, corporations, and philanthropic foundations.
  • Oversee all sponsorship inquiries for events, collaborating with the Development Manager to define sponsorship tiers.
  • Explore and implement new fundraising strategies and opportunities.
  • Represent God's Pantry Food Bank with professionalism, building strong connections with partners, sponsors, attendees, vendors, agencies, volunteers, and the broader community to support the Food Bank's mission.
  • Engage with corporate entities to provide updates on Food Bank initiatives, seek support, acknowledge contributions, and advocate for hunger relief in the region.
  • Participate in community and social gatherings to network and identify potential sponsors and partners.
  • Work alongside team members to enhance the Faith-Based Partnership Program, focusing on expanding outreach and strengthening existing relationships.

Event Management

  • Lead the planning and execution of fundraising events, including staffing, budgeting, design, and logistics.
  • Coordinate signature events in collaboration with the Development Team and external partners.
  • Collaborate with the Employee & Community Engagement Team to develop comprehensive marketing strategies and promotional materials for events.
  • Enhance existing events to maximize their effectiveness and community impact.
  • Maintain detailed records of event planning, sponsorship requests, and outreach efforts.
  • Partner with fellow coordinators to secure auction items to increase fundraising revenue.

Donor Stewardship

  • Assist in the stewardship of donors, partners, sponsors, volunteers, and event participants.
  • Collaborate with the Development Team to organize an annual donor appreciation event.
